very slow open and save jpg images from Sony RX 100 camera
Environment/Versions
- GIMP version: 2.10.24
- Package: Gimp for Windows download from gimp.org
- Operating System: Windows 10 rev. 2004 64bit (8GB RAM)
Description of the bug
Jpeg images produced by the Sony RX 100 camera load and save very slow. When i open a picture (about 4,5 mb 10 megapixel) it takes ~ 15 seconds for finishing. The same effect occur by the "Export as..." menu. When i export the jpg image again as jpg (by pressing the Export button red 1 in screenshot) it takes again 15 sec. before the the export properties dialog (with the red 2 in the screenshot) is showing. By confirming the settings again 15 sec. is required for saving the file.
After some investigations after cut off the exif data via the jhead -de command the same image loads and saves in ~3 seconds. I found that images from other cameras have no such problems. Loading and saving is very quickly. The problem exists not in Gimp 2.10.18. It seems to be the Sony RX 100 produces very special or problematic exif data. The behaviour can reproduced with attached original camera file Sony-RX100-image.jpg.
